Description

Blockfront, slantfront desk with ball and claw feet (new, circa 1920). Four graduated drawers with brasses; lid supports; brass handles on each side (new). Interior has central hinged door flanked by two tiers of drawers surmounted by pigeon holes with shaped brackets. Entire piece has been stained and varnished--Victorian or turn of the century--possible period interior with new exterior??
